Comprehending Various Karate Styles
When you start discovering martial arts, comprehending the different styles can substantially enhance your training experience. Each style has special techniques, philosophies, and focuses.
For example, Shotokan stresses effective strikes and linear movements, while Goju-Ryu blends difficult and soft techniques, integrating circular movements. If you favor a much more fluid method, think about Wado-Ryu, which prioritizes evasion and harmony.
Kyokushin, on the other hand, is recognized for its full-contact sparring and strenuous training routine. As you evaluate your interests and goals, consider what resonates with you most.

Reviewing Teachers and Educating Environments
As you search for the ideal karate classes, reviewing teachers and training settings is important for your success and comfort.
Begin by observing the teachers' qualifications and experience. A professional teacher shouldn't only have knowledge in karate yet likewise have strong mentor skills. Look for importance of martial arts who connects clearly and reveals real rate of interest in their students' progression.
Next off, examine the training setting. Is the dojo tidy, arranged, and safe? Think about the course dimension; smaller classes commonly allow for more customized focus.
